aGrUM  0.17.2
a C++ library for (probabilistic) graphical models
gum::IMarkovNet< GUM_SCALAR > Member List

This is the complete list of members for gum::IMarkovNet< GUM_SCALAR >, including all inherited members.

_graphgum::UGmodelprotected
completeInstantiation() constgum::GraphicalModel
dim() constgum::IMarkovNet< GUM_SCALAR >
edges() constgum::UGmodel
empty() constgum::GraphicalModelvirtual
factor(const NodeSet &varIds) const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
factors() const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
graph() constgum::UGmodel
GraphicalModel()gum::GraphicalModel
GraphicalModel(const GraphicalModel &source)gum::GraphicalModel
hasSameStructure(const UGmodel &other)gum::UGmodel
idFromName(const std::string &name) const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
IMarkovNet()gum::IMarkovNet< GUM_SCALAR >
IMarkovNet(std::string name)gum::IMarkovNet< GUM_SCALAR >explicit
IMarkovNet(const IMarkovNet< GUM_SCALAR > &source)gum::IMarkovNet< GUM_SCALAR >
log10DomainSize() constgum::GraphicalModel
maxNonOneParam() constgum::IMarkovNet< GUM_SCALAR >
maxParam() constgum::IMarkovNet< GUM_SCALAR >
maxVarDomainSize() constgum::IMarkovNet< GUM_SCALAR >
minNonZeroParam() constgum::IMarkovNet< GUM_SCALAR >
minParam() constgum::IMarkovNet< GUM_SCALAR >
neighbours(const NodeId id) constgum::UGmodel
neighbours(const std::string &name) constgum::UGmodel
nodeId(const DiscreteVariable &var) const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
nodes() constgum::UGmodelvirtual
operator!=(const IMarkovNet< GUM_SCALAR > &from) constgum::IMarkovNet< GUM_SCALAR >
operator=(const IMarkovNet< GUM_SCALAR > &source)gum::IMarkovNet< GUM_SCALAR >
gum::UGmodel::operator=(const UGmodel &source)gum::UGmodelprotected
gum::GraphicalModel::operator=(const GraphicalModel &source)gum::GraphicalModelprotected
operator==(const IMarkovNet< GUM_SCALAR > &from) constgum::IMarkovNet< GUM_SCALAR >
property(const std::string &name) constgum::GraphicalModel
propertyWithDefault(const std::string &name, const std::string &byDefault) constgum::GraphicalModel
setProperty(const std::string &name, const std::string &value)gum::GraphicalModel
size() const finalgum::UGmodelvirtual
sizeEdges() constgum::UGmodel
toDot() constgum::IMarkovNet< GUM_SCALAR >virtual
toString() constgum::IMarkovNet< GUM_SCALAR >
UGmodel()gum::UGmodel
UGmodel(const UGmodel &source)gum::UGmodel
variable(NodeId id) const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
variableFromName(const std::string &name) const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
variableNodeMap() const =0gum::IMarkovNet< GUM_SCALAR >pure virtual
~GraphicalModel()gum::GraphicalModelvirtual
~IMarkovNet()gum::IMarkovNet< GUM_SCALAR >virtual
~UGmodel()gum::UGmodelvirtual